Guest
Login
Sign Up
Site settings
Forgot Password?
Spinning the rotors and popping Huge thanks for all the love and hate guys! For all the petrol (or gear-) heads here: check out and subscribe my other channel, where I post ridiculous car content every week.
Autoplay video
Hide player controls
Hide resume playing